The Center on Disability Studies, College of Education, University of Hawaiʻi at Mānoa, is delighted to announce the release of the latest issue of Review of Disability Studies: An International Journal (Volume 20 Number 4).
This issue brings together interdisciplinary research in disability studies spanning education policy, assistive technology, arts, Indigenous knowledge, and disability history. Plain language versions of all abstracts may be viewed at the Plain Language Abstracts. The full issue may be accessed without charge at our RDS Journal.

In its 41st year, the Pacific Rim International Conference is the premier global gathering for people committed to improving the lives of people with disabilities. Since 1988, it has been organized by the Center on Disability Studies, College of Education, University of Hawaiʻi at Mānoa.

Center on Disability Studies, College of Education, University of Hawaiʻi at Mānoa
Through continuing efforts in Education & Early Intervention, Employment, & Community Living, the Center on Disability Studies helps provide thousands of people with disabilities and their families, Native Hawaiians, Pacific Islanders, and other underrepresented populations, the pathway to empowered lives of full participation and access. We also provide the students of the University of Hawaiʻi and partner institutions with innovative, interdisciplinary research and service opportunities to engage in meaningful community-based learning and advocacy.
